Emacs org-display-inline-images
Как отображать встроенные изображения в режиме emacs org?
У меня есть [[file:~/myimage.png]]
, который при нажатии открывается в новом буфере.
Но как это сделать в том же буфере?
Примечание. C c C x C v - undefined, поэтому я не смог активировать встроенные изображения, но как решить эту проблему?
Ответы
Ответ 1
Это работает для меня:
(defun do-org-show-all-inline-images ()
(interactive)
(org-display-inline-images t t))
(global-set-key (kbd "C-c C-x C v")
'do-org-show-all-inline-images)
И вот как я нашел, как это сделать:
- M-x apropos RET
org.*image.*
.
- F1 f
org-display-inline-images
.
- Сделайте test.org со ссылкой на картинку.
- M-:
(org-display-inline-images t t)
.
- оберните его в
defun
/global-set-key
.
Ответ 2
вам не нужно определять настраиваемую функцию, такую как @abo-abo, org-mode предоставляет такие функции:
M-x
- org-redisplay-inline-images
- org-display-inline-images
- org-toggle-inline-images
- org-remove-inline-images
M-x org-toggle-inline-images is quite enough for me , which toggle display/hiden inline images